Product reviews:
Lewis
2026-01-20 iphone 11 Pro
90cm Large Tyrannosaurus Doll Dinosaur large dinosaur stuffed animal
large dinosaur stuffed animal
Large T-Rex Plush,Giant Tyrannosaurus large dinosaur stuffed animal
large dinosaur stuffed animal
Oliver
2026-01-18 iphone 7 Plus
16 Inch Large Dinosaur Stuffed Animal large dinosaur stuffed animal
large dinosaur stuffed animal